13 Shot by U.S. Homeland Security Officers in Operations Targeting Migrants

Thirteen people have been shot by U.S. Department of Homeland Security law enforcement officers during operations targeting migrants in cities across the United States, four of whom died, NBC News reported.

The network said on Thursday it had compiled data on killings and shootings carried out by federal security units under the Department of Homeland Security since September 2025.

According to the report, 13 people were shot during migrant-related operations over the past five months, including four fatalities.

NBC News said those shot included individuals described as “suspects,” undocumented migrants, as well as U.S. citizens.

The Department of Homeland Security did not immediately respond to a request for comment.
